tejashri.gandhi Ответов: 2

событие jquery change() не срабатывает


У меня есть два раскрывающихся списка и одно текстовое поле. Я хочу отобразить умножение выбранных значений из обоих выпадающих списков.

Я пытаюсь использовать функцию change() в jQuery. Однако функция изменения не срабатывает. Даже если бы я попробовал обычную тревогу с ним ничего не происходит.


$('#container select').change(function () {
             alert(this).html();
        });


Я использую IE6 и jquery-1.4.1.min.js

2 Ответов

Рейтинг:
17

member60

я не знаю, работает ли это:

alert(this).html()

я имею в виду сначала проверить простое предупреждение например:
alert('hello');

если это работает , то прекрасно, в противном случае
пробовать:
$('#controlId').live('change', function (e) {
alert('Hello');
        });
});


tejashri.gandhi

Спасибо Вам большое...это сработало..

member60

отлично!

Рейтинг:
1

P.Salini

Я ожидаю этого container select это идентификатор выпадающего списка в вашем коде.

Если это так, то удалите пространство между ними. container и select а потом попробуй еще раз